Two Year Acting Program - Claire Ganshert 03 - (917) 794-3878Before I came to the Maggie Flanigan Studio, I genuinely attempted this career without seeking proper training. Having all of the administrative career items in place (headshot, resume, reel), when it came time to walk into an audition, I didn’t have an ounce of confidence. I couldn’t tell you why I wanted to be an actor. A bachelor’s degree in Theater Performance taught me that acting is a form of art, but I had no real experience of being an artist, and certainly didn’t consider myself one. I felt I had no right in pursuing this career. After being scammed by film producers holding acting classes, older failed actors taking advantage of young artists, and directors teaching small exercises using a variety of techniques, I had a hodgepodge of training, with no concrete way of working.

The Reality of Hack Actors

Charlie Sandlan introduced me to the reality of hack actors, who give hardworking actors, and the art form of acting itself, a shameful reputation. He explained how Maggie Flanigan Studio trains artists, and gave me an opportunity to have something for myself that no one could ever take away from me: Craft. Charlie had directly addressed a longing in me, that, at the time, I didn’t have articulation for.

In class, Charlie often says, “I don’t care if you’re talented. You will only ever be as good as your crafting.” There was no laziness allowed, and Charlie cultivated a passion in me where I did not tolerate laziness for myself either. Work ethic is prized at Maggie Flanigan Studio, and the result for me was unearthing unrealized potential on a consistent basis.

Personal Attention

The faculty saw qualities and potential in me I didn’t realized existed. They got to know me as a person, as an artist, and learned how to teach me, the individual, which is something that possibly no other studio offers. Their specific attention is unique to any other studio in the country. Incoming faculty members coming from university acting programs even expressed a notice in change from their previous environments: “they talk about each individual student in the staff meeting every week. I’ve never seen this done anywhere else I’ve taught before.”

More Than Just An Acting Program

The experience at Maggie Flanigan Studio was so much more than an acting program for me. I received a sense of work ethic, empowerment, and awareness for myself that has been transformational, both personally, and artistically. Nothing was spoon fed; I had to work for what I wanted. Now I can confidently express why I want to be an actor, and how I can be of service to humanity, by sharing and responding from my artistry. Having just finished the Maggie Flanigan Studio Professional Actor Training Program, I’m a different person, and this is a whole new career.
